How popular is the name Juda?

Juda is a unique baby name in Netherlands, during its short term of usage, the name has been to the top 400 names. Recently in 2016, it achieved its highest ever ranking of 358 on boy names chart when 43 babies were named Juda.

The moniker is an uncommon baby name in United States, even after 47 years of presence it could not make beyond the top 2000. Over 411 babies in United States have been named Juda.

Juda is a rare baby name in Netherlands still in use today. Juda is a common name in Zimbabwe and DR Congo while somewhat familiar name in South Africa, India, Indonesia, Philippines, Brazil, Papua New Guinea, Nigeria and Mexico.

As per our estimate, over 6000 people has been named Juda globally.
